The Quillbrook config service supports hot-reloading: any change written to the active profile is picked up by running Lanternd instances within ten seconds, without a restart. Please verify changes in the staging profile first, as malformed values are rejected silently. To query the reload status endpoint, authenticate with the key below.

service key, fawip-bajef: kto11_Qt5wZK9vdNC

Subject: Marledge franchise agreement — where we stand

Hi all,

Quick update for the department heads before Friday's exec call. The Marledge Hospitality franchise agreement is nearly final — we've settled territory rights for the Avenmoor region and the royalty tiers, but their team is still pushing back on the training-cost split. We think we can close by month-end without giving much ground. Please keep this within this group until signatures are in. The bigger strategic picture is captured in the confidential note below.

confidential, bahap-bajog: Zorethix Works is in early talks to buy Kelethox Foods for about $30.7 million. The Ralvan launch date is September 19, and nothing goes to the press before then.

Handover Note — Marketing Budget Cut

From: Director Pell Ashover. To: incoming director.

Budget for the Northvale region cut eighteen percent, effective immediately. Sponsorships at the Carden trade fairs cancelled; penalties already negotiated down. Digital spend protected for the Merrow launch only. Agency retainer with Bluecroft Media renegotiated to month-to-month. Headcount untouched for now, but two contractor roles end at quarter close. Track savings weekly and report to finance. The underlying plan driving these cuts is noted below.

board note of kafog-fawep: The pricing group signed off on a budget of $7.1 million for Project Lamion. The renewal with Gilathix Holdings closes at $60.4 million a year, 43 percent below the last contract.